complexType LinkLocation
diagram
namespace http://www.ite.org/tmdd
children link-ownership link-designator link-id link-name primary-location secondary-location link-direction link-alignment linear-reference linear-reference-version alternate-designation
used by
elements LinkLocation/alternate-designation AlternateRouteDetail/location-on-alternate-route/location-on-alternate-route-item EventLocation/location-on-link
annotation
documentation
<objectClass>Event</objectClass>
<definition/>
source <xs:complexType name="LinkLocation">
 
<xs:annotation>
   
<xs:documentation>
     
<objectClass>Event</objectClass>
     
<definition/>
   
</xs:documentation>
 
</xs:annotation>
 
<xs:sequence>
   
<xs:element name="link-ownership" type="Link-ownership">
     
<xs:annotation>
       
<xs:documentation>
         
<requirement>REQ967</requirement>
       
</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="link-designator" type="Link-route-designator" minOccurs="0">
     
<xs:annotation>
       
<xs:documentation>
         
<requirement>REQ968</requirement>
       
</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="link-id" type="Roadway-network-identifier" minOccurs="0">
     
<xs:annotation>
       
<xs:documentation>
         
<requirement>REQ969</requirement>
       
</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="link-name" type="Roadway-network-name" minOccurs="0">
     
<xs:annotation>
       
<xs:documentation>
         
<requirement>REQ970</requirement>
       
</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="primary-location" type="PointOnLink">
     
<xs:annotation>
       
<xs:documentation>
         
<requirement>REQ967</requirement>
       
</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="secondary-location" type="PointOnLink" minOccurs="0">
     
<xs:annotation>
       
<xs:documentation>
         
<requirement>REQ972</requirement>
       
</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="link-direction" type="Link-direction">
     
<xs:annotation>
       
<xs:documentation>
         
<requirement>REQ967</requirement>
       
</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="link-alignment" type="Link-alignment" minOccurs="0">
     
<xs:annotation>
       
<xs:documentation>
         
<requirement>REQ971</requirement>
       
</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="linear-reference" type="Link-location-linear-reference" minOccurs="0">
     
<xs:annotation>
       
<xs:documentation>
         
<requirement>REQ973</requirement>
       
</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="linear-reference-version" type="Link-location-linear-reference-version" minOccurs="0">
     
<xs:annotation>
       
<xs:documentation>
         
<requirement>REQ973</requirement>
       
</xs:documentation>
     
</xs:annotation>
   
</xs:element>
   
<xs:element name="alternate-designation" type="LinkLocation" minOccurs="0">
     
<xs:annotation>
       
<xs:documentation>
         
<requirement>REQ974</requirement>
       
</xs:documentation>
     
</xs:annotation>
   
</xs:element>
 
</xs:sequence>
</xs:complexType>

element LinkLocation/link-ownership
diagram
type Link-ownership
properties
isRef 0
content simple
facets
minLength 1
maxLength 256
annotation
documentation
<requirement>REQ967</requirement>
source <xs:element name="link-ownership" type="Link-ownership">
 
<xs:annotation>
   
<xs:documentation>
     
<requirement>REQ967</requirement>
   
</xs:documentation>
 
</xs:annotation>
</xs:element>

element LinkLocation/link-designator
diagram
type Link-route-designator
properties
isRef 0
minOcc 0
maxOcc 1
content simple
facets
minLength 1
maxLength 64
annotation
documentation
<requirement>REQ968</requirement>
source <xs:element name="link-designator" type="Link-route-designator" minOccurs="0">
 
<xs:annotation>
   
<xs:documentation>
     
<requirement>REQ968</requirement>
   
</xs:documentation>
 
</xs:annotation>
</xs:element>

element LinkLocation/link-id
diagram
type Roadway-network-identifier
properties
isRef 0
minOcc 0
maxOcc 1
content simple
facets
minLength 1
maxLength 32
annotation
documentation
<requirement>REQ969</requirement>
source <xs:element name="link-id" type="Roadway-network-identifier" minOccurs="0">
 
<xs:annotation>
   
<xs:documentation>
     
<requirement>REQ969</requirement>
   
</xs:documentation>
 
</xs:annotation>
</xs:element>

element LinkLocation/link-name
diagram
type Roadway-network-name
properties
isRef 0
minOcc 0
maxOcc 1
content simple
facets
minLength 1
maxLength 128
annotation
documentation
<requirement>REQ970</requirement>
source <xs:element name="link-name" type="Roadway-network-name" minOccurs="0">
 
<xs:annotation>
   
<xs:documentation>
     
<requirement>REQ970</requirement>
   
</xs:documentation>
 
</xs:annotation>
</xs:element>

element LinkLocation/primary-location
diagram
type PointOnLink
properties
isRef 0
content complex
children geo-location linear-reference linear-reference-version link-name point-name cross-street-designator cross-street-name signed-destination location-rank landmark-location upward-area-reference
annotation
documentation
<requirement>REQ967</requirement>
source <xs:element name="primary-location" type="PointOnLink">
 
<xs:annotation>
   
<xs:documentation>
     
<requirement>REQ967</requirement>
   
</xs:documentation>
 
</xs:annotation>
</xs:element>

element LinkLocation/secondary-location
diagram
type PointOnLink
properties
isRef 0
minOcc 0
maxOcc 1
content complex
children geo-location linear-reference linear-reference-version link-name point-name cross-street-designator cross-street-name signed-destination location-rank landmark-location upward-area-reference
annotation
documentation
<requirement>REQ972</requirement>
source <xs:element name="secondary-location" type="PointOnLink" minOccurs="0">
 
<xs:annotation>
   
<xs:documentation>
     
<requirement>REQ972</requirement>
   
</xs:documentation>
 
</xs:annotation>
</xs:element>

element LinkLocation/link-direction
diagram
type Link-direction
properties
isRef 0
content simple
annotation
documentation
<requirement>REQ967</requirement>
source <xs:element name="link-direction" type="Link-direction">
 
<xs:annotation>
   
<xs:documentation>
     
<requirement>REQ967</requirement>
   
</xs:documentation>
 
</xs:annotation>
</xs:element>

element LinkLocation/link-alignment
diagram
type Link-alignment
properties
isRef 0
minOcc 0
maxOcc 1
content simple
annotation
documentation
<requirement>REQ971</requirement>
source <xs:element name="link-alignment" type="Link-alignment" minOccurs="0">
 
<xs:annotation>
   
<xs:documentation>
     
<requirement>REQ971</requirement>
   
</xs:documentation>
 
</xs:annotation>
</xs:element>

element LinkLocation/linear-reference
diagram
type Link-location-linear-reference
properties
isRef 0
minOcc 0
maxOcc 1
content simple
facets
minInclusive 0
maxInclusive 2000000
annotation
documentation
<requirement>REQ973</requirement>
source <xs:element name="linear-reference" type="Link-location-linear-reference" minOccurs="0">
 
<xs:annotation>
   
<xs:documentation>
     
<requirement>REQ973</requirement>
   
</xs:documentation>
 
</xs:annotation>
</xs:element>

element LinkLocation/linear-reference-version
diagram
type Link-location-linear-reference-version
properties
isRef 0
minOcc 0
maxOcc 1
content simple
annotation
documentation
<requirement>REQ973</requirement>
source <xs:element name="linear-reference-version" type="Link-location-linear-reference-version" minOccurs="0">
 
<xs:annotation>
   
<xs:documentation>
     
<requirement>REQ973</requirement>
   
</xs:documentation>
 
</xs:annotation>
</xs:element>

element LinkLocation/alternate-designation
diagram
type LinkLocation
properties
isRef 0
minOcc 0
maxOcc 1
content complex
children link-ownership link-designator link-id link-name primary-location secondary-location link-direction link-alignment linear-reference linear-reference-version alternate-designation
annotation
documentation
<requirement>REQ974</requirement>
source <xs:element name="alternate-designation" type="LinkLocation" minOccurs="0">
 
<xs:annotation>
   
<xs:documentation>
     
<requirement>REQ974</requirement>
   
</xs:documentation>
 
</xs:annotation>
</xs:element>


XML Schema documentation generated by
XMLSpy Schema Editor http://www.altova.com/xmlspy